Out-of-town guests often shape the transportation plan before the wedding day schedule is even final. If relatives are arriving from outside Valencia County, or if some guests are connecting through the Albuquerque airport area, it helps to think beyond a single arrival time and build a plan around groups: early family, wedding party members, hotel block guests, and late arrivals who may need clear pickup instructions.

For Belen New Mexico Wedding Transportation And Limousine Service planning, the right vehicle choice usually starts with passenger count and trip purpose. A smaller vehicle can be practical for the couple, parents, or VIP family members, while a shuttle-style option may be a better fit for moving guests between hotels, the ceremony, the reception, and end-of-night return points. Larger groups should also consider luggage, formalwear, mobility needs, and whether guests will be traveling together or in staggered waves.

  • When do airport arrivals begin, and are guests landing close together or spread across the day?
  • What time should the wedding party leave for photos, dressing, or the ceremony location?
  • How many guests are staying in hotel blocks, and will pickup happen at one point or several?
  • Is the ceremony-to-reception transfer immediate, or is there a gap that changes vehicle timing?
  • Where can vehicles load and unload without creating confusion for older guests or families?
  • What late-night return schedule makes sense after the final send-off or reception closing time?

Quote preparation is easier when you have a rough headcount, addresses or general pickup areas, the number of separate trips, and the time each movement should begin. If you are still comparing vendors, ask how they handle schedule changes, multiple pickup windows, airport arrival coordination, and the difference between a limousine-style ride, a party bus-style experience, and a shuttle focused mainly on moving guests efficiently.

Belen weddings can involve a mix of local attendees and guests coming from other New Mexico communities, so a simple written transportation outline is valuable. Share pickup times with your planner, venue contact, photographer, and wedding party, then give guests plain instructions about where to stand, when to be ready, and who the transportation is intended for.

A strong plan begins with identifying the moments when transportation matters most. Some weddings need a single pre-ceremony shuttle and one end-of-night return. Others require multiple loops, wedding party movements before photos, family transfers, or a charter bus for wedding guests traveling together from a regional pickup point. By mapping these needs early, you can select vehicles and schedules that fit the size and pace of your event.

Hotel-to-venue guest shuttle coordination is one of the most common reasons couples request wedding transportation in Belen. When guests are unfamiliar with the area, a shuttle gives them a dependable plan for arrival and return. It also reduces the number of separate vehicles arriving at the same time and gives your planner, venue team, or family point person a clearer sense of when guests will be present.

For a smaller guest list, a mini bus hotel shuttle can be a practical choice because it is easier to schedule around a few pickup waves. If the guest count is larger, a full-size charter bus may help move more people at once and reduce the number of trips needed. For some weddings, a school bus guest shuttle can be a straightforward option for short-distance guest movement, especially when the focus is efficient transportation rather than premium onboard features.

The most useful hotel shuttle plans include specific pickup times, a clear loading location, and an assigned person who can help guests board. Couples should avoid vague instructions such as “be ready around the ceremony time.” Instead, build a schedule with a first loading window, a final departure time, and a return plan that guests can understand before the wedding day.

Building a Shuttle Timeline That Keeps the Day on Schedule

Wedding transportation works best when the route and timing are designed around the event schedule, not added as an afterthought. In Belen, couples should plan backward from the ceremony start time and include enough buffer for loading, guest questions, mobility needs, and any last-minute adjustments. Even when distances are manageable, loading a full shuttle takes time, and guests often arrive at the pickup point in small groups instead of all at once.

If your ceremony and reception are in different locations, ceremony-to-reception transfers need their own timeline. Guests should know whether they are expected to board immediately after the ceremony, after photos, or after a receiving line. The shuttle should also be scheduled so the reception does not begin before the last guest transfer has arrived. For weddings with separate family photo sessions, it may be useful to hold one vehicle for family members while another moves general guests.

Late-night return rides should be planned with the same care as the arrival trip. Some couples schedule one early return for guests who do not want to stay until the end and one final return after the reception. Others prefer a continuous loop for a defined period. The right answer depends on guest count, vehicle size, lodging arrangement, and how many people are expected to use the shuttle after the reception.

Vehicle selection should follow the actual transportation job. A wedding party arrival has different needs than a guest shuttle. A charter bus for wedding guests is different from a party bus used for pre-ceremony movement or photos. A limousine or specialty vehicle can be appropriate for a couple’s arrival or family transport, while a mini bus may be better for hotel shuttles and smaller groups.

When deciding between school bus guest shuttles, mini buses, charter buses, party buses, and limousine or specialty vehicles, consider the number of passengers, number of trips, timing pressure, and the experience you want guests to have. A larger bus can simplify planning by moving many guests at once, but a smaller vehicle may be easier to match to multiple pickup waves. For wedding party transportation, comfort, schedule control, and keeping the group together may matter more than total capacity.

The best vehicle plan may include more than one type of transportation. For example, guests may use a mini bus or charter bus shuttle while the wedding party uses a party bus or specialty vehicle for separate movement. Families may need a dedicated vehicle for early arrival. Thinking in terms of transportation roles, rather than choosing one vehicle for every purpose, helps create a cleaner wedding-day plan.

For regional guest movement, couples often choose between a central pickup model and a multi-stop model. A central pickup can be easier to manage because everyone boards at one place, but it requires guests to reach that location on their own. A multi-stop shuttle may be more convenient for guests, but it adds time and requires tighter communication. The right approach depends on how many guests are in each nearby area and how much schedule flexibility exists before the ceremony.

Guest shuttles are only one part of the day. Wedding party transportation may need to begin earlier, run on a separate schedule, or stay available for photos and pre-reception movement. A party bus can help keep attendants together, while a limousine or specialty vehicle may be preferred for certain arrivals. For immediate family members, a dedicated mini bus or smaller charter option can simplify early arrivals and make sure key people are where they need to be.

Couples should identify which people must arrive before guests and which people need transportation after the ceremony. This can include the couple, wedding party, close family, readers, or anyone involved in photos or formal entrances. If these groups are mixed into the general guest shuttle without planning, they may arrive too late or get separated during the transition between ceremony and reception.

A good wedding transportation plan assigns each group to a vehicle and a time window. It also names a point person who can answer questions on the wedding day. That person does not have to manage every detail, but they should know who is expected to ride, when the vehicle leaves, and what to do if someone is missing at departure time.

Making Belen Wedding Transportation Simple for Guests

The most successful wedding shuttle plans are easy for guests to understand. Once your schedule is confirmed, share transportation instructions through your wedding website, invitation details, or direct guest communication. Include pickup time, where to wait, whether the shuttle is optional or strongly recommended, and what return options will be available after the reception.

For Belen weddings, clarity matters because many guests may be relying on the couple’s instructions rather than their own local knowledge. Use consistent names for pickup points, avoid changing the schedule at the last minute, and make sure the final return plan is communicated before the reception begins. If you are offering multiple return rides, list the times clearly so guests can choose the option that fits them.
